Future Developments of Blast Furnace Aerodynamics
Following a summary of aerodynamic principles and the changes imposed by the process, areas important to the operator are then enumerated. These include furnace lines, cooling and casting technology, coke properties, gas distribution and others. Questions are raised on the implication of lowering the hearth substantially below the tuyeres and about the status of stack injection. Finally, the future developments are identified as being those associated with gas volumes required to pass through the furnace stack per unit time or per tonne of product.
